Out of interest is a decat legal and what's the fine if you are caught? Is it a case of having the cats put back on just for the MOT?
Its an MOT failure if the tester realises they have been removedThough spotting that is hard as most the underside is covered metal plates
The Primary cats are normally enough to pass the emissions test

It might also be worth pointing out that the V12 has two sets of cats. Therefore it is possible to remove one set (ie the decat mentioned above) without causing emissions warning lights to come on.This isn't possible with the single set of cats on the V8V. 200 cell cats is the route to go down.
